[b]Granada in Three Days: A Must-See Itinerary[/b] Nestled in the center of this vibrant region, Granada offers an captivating blend of heritage, tradition, and natural beauty. A 72-hour journey through this destination promises an memorable experience, rooted in centuries of creativity and tradition. Begin your adventure by exploring the world-renowned Alhambra, a palatial fortress that unveils the history of Moorish rulers and their influence. Stroll through the Generalife Gardens, where the fusion between flora and design offers a serene escape. The Albaicin district, a UNESCO World Heritage site, is great for meandering its narrow, winding streets. From its hilltop vantage points, the panoramas of the Alhambra and Sierra Nevada mountains are breathtaking. Dive into the rich local culture with a visit to the Sacromonte neighborhood, celebrated for its traditional cave dwellings and gypsy dances. In the evenings, savor the authentic tastes of Andalusian cuisine at traditional tapas bars. Your second day might lead you to the Royal Chapel and Granada Cathedral, beautiful examples of Spanish Renaissance and medieval design. Nearby, the colorful Alcaiceria market provides a chance to shop for one-of-a-kind crafts and souvenirs. A hike in the surrounding hills or a visit to the ancient Arab baths could be the ideal way to unwind. For your last day, visit the Sierra Nevada National Park for a taste of Granada’s majestic scenery. Whether hitting the slopes or trailing during warmer months, this impressive range offers an refreshing contrast to the city’s old-world charm. Conclude your stay with a leisurely evening walk along Carrera del Darro, one of Granada’s most scenic streets. Tap water in Barcelona complies with EU regulations, adhering to stringent guidelines for quality. However, its flavor can fluctuate due to its mineral composition and the treatment process. Many locals and visitors opt for mineral water for its cleaner profile, but using tap water for boiling and rinsing produce is frequent. For those sensitive to taste, a water filter system can serve as an cost-effective and sustainable solution during your stay.
